**1. Martin Luther King Jr. National Historical Park**

Located in the heart of Atlanta, this national park is a must-visit for anyone interested in history and civil rights. Take a tour of Dr. King’s birthplace, the Ebenezer Baptist Church, and his tomb, which are all part of the park’s sprawling complex. You can also visit the Martin Luther King Jr. Center for Nonviolent Social Change, where you’ll learn about his life and legacy.

**2. Georgia Aquarium**

Get ready to be amazed by one of the largest aquariums in the world! With thousands of aquatic animals from around the globe, including whale sharks, dolphins, and penguins, the Georgia Aquarium is an unforgettable experience for visitors of all ages. Be sure to check out the colorful exhibits and interactive displays that make learning about marine life fun and engaging.

**3. World of Coca-Cola**

Who doesn’t love a good dose of nostalgia and entertainment? The World of Coca-Cola is a must-visit attraction for anyone interested in history, marketing, or simply having a great time. With over 1,200 artifacts on display, you can explore the origins of the iconic brand, taste flavors from around the world, and even take home some exclusive souvenirs.

**4. Centennial Olympic Park**

This beautiful 21-acre park was built for the 1996 Summer Olympics and has since become a beloved gathering space for locals and visitors alike. Take a stroll through the picturesque gardens, rent a paddleboat and enjoy the scenic lake views, or attend one of the many events and concerts held here throughout the year.

**5. Atlanta BeltLine**

Get ready to explore one of the most innovative urban redevelopment projects in the country! The Atlanta BeltLine is a former railway corridor turned multi-use trail that offers stunning views of the city skyline, public art installations, and plenty of opportunities for hiking, biking, or simply taking in the sights. Whether you’re interested in history, architecture, or just getting some exercise, this attraction has something for everyone.
